Tulip Tank Top
Another elegant freebie from those clever girls at Purl Soho! Tulip is a simple tank that crosses over in the back, creating a clever design detail with little effort. The project involves a few short rows, so it isn’t for the absolute beginner, but an advanced beginner or intermediate knitter should be ok.
It calls for Louet Euroflax Sport, but you could also go a notch more luxe with Quince & Co Sparrow, or shift down to silky soft and budget friendly Cascade Ultra Pima.
Size
- Finished Chest Circumference: 31 (35, 39, 43, 47) inches
- Length from Shoulder to Bottom Edge: 22 ½ (23, 23 ½, 24, 24 ½) inches
- Length from Underarm to Bottom Edge: 14 inches
- Ease: This garment is designed with 2 to 4 inches of positive ease (it’s supposed to be worn loose)
Yarn Options
You can use any of the following yarn options ….
Louet Euroflax Sport: 3 (3, 4, 4, 5) skeins
Quince & Co Sparrow: 5(5, 6, 7, 8) skeins
Cascade Ultra Pima: 4(4, 5, 5, 7)
Other Materials
- 3.75mm/US5 – 32″ circular needles
- 3.25mm/US3 – 32″ circular needles
- 3.25mm/US3 – 16″ or 24″ circular needles
- 2 stitch markers
